MIAMI-Terranova is on a retail roll. The company just announced a string of new leases at its shopping centers, including deals at Biscayne Plaza Shopping Center, Suniland Shopping Center, El Mercado Shopping Center and Westfork Plaza.

Stephen Bittel, Chairman and CEO of Terranova, tells GlobeSt.com the national chains are singing leases again. That’s good news for the South Florida economy, since retail is an early indicator of recovery.

“Retail sales are translating into new retail tenants from the national chains,” Bittel says. “Local tenants are still struggling to obtain financing. South Florida is among the healthier retail markets nationally, and South Broward and Miami-Dade counties are probably the healthiest in South Florida.”
